Misha Krupin Inspires Troops with Music and Motivation in Military Service
When the stage lights dimmed and the curtain fell on Misha Krupin's last concert, few could have anticipated his next act would be on the front lines of Ukraine's defense. Misha Krupin, a renowned artist, has traded his microphone for military gear, joining the 413th Separate Battalion "Raid" of the Unmanned Systems Forces of the Ukrainian Armed Forces.
A New Chapter Begins for Misha Krupin
Krupin's journey into the military began with rigorous training that spanned two months, preparing him for the challenging role of carrying out combat missions. This transition marks a significant shift from his previous life as a musician, but it has not dimmed his creative spirit.
"Our enemies should fear, " says Krupin confidently. "We have no reason to be afraid."

From Charity to Camouflage
Before donning the uniform, Krupin was actively involved in supporting the Ukrainian military through charitable tours. His dedication to the cause was evident as he embarked on tours across de-occupied cities and hot zones, providing moral and psychological support to troops.
Encouraging Voluntary Service
Krupin passionately advocates for voluntary enlistment, urging men to join the ranks without waiting for a draft notice. His message is straightforward and resonant: "Come forward willingly, as the military welcomes those who take the initiative."
